Text For Citation: 01 Item/Group: 003E Hazard:
29 CFR 1910.1025(e)(4)(i): When ventilation was used to control exposure to lead, measurements which demonstrate the effectiveness of the system in controlling exposure were not made at least every three months: a) Entire Facility: Range Safety Officers (RSOs) observing/instructing customers and performing cleaning in the range were exposed to lead above the 8-hour Time Weighted Average OSHA Permissible Exposure Limit of 50 ug/m3 (micrograms of lead per cubic meter of air) and the employer did not ensure that measurements which demonstrated the effectiveness of the system were made at least every three (3) months; on or about 5/12/18. b) Inside the Shooting Range: A Range Safety Officer (RSO) who performed cleanup of the range through dry sweeping, shoveling and vacuuming of lead debris was exposed to lead above the 8-hour Time Weighted Average OSHA Permissible Exposure Limit of 50 ug/m3 (micrograms of lead per cubic meter of air) of lead and the employer did not ensure that measurements which demonstrated the effectiveness of the system were made at least every three (3) months; on or about 6/18/18.
